Advancing Wastewater Treatment: The Power of MABR Technology

Wastewater treatment is experiencing a revolution thanks to the innovative integration of Membrane Aerated Bioreactor (MABR) technology. This cutting-edge system offers marked advantages over conventional methods, producing higher treatment efficiency and reduced environmental impact. MABR systems utilize fine membranes to facilitate oxygen transfer and microbial growth, effectively purifying pollutants from wastewater.

As a result, MABR technology is poised to redefine the wastewater treatment industry, providing cleaner water and mitigating environmental pollution.
